使用PathCchAppend时,相对路径引用某个父
"..\..\folder1\" + "folder2"
结果是
"folder1\folder2\"
而不是
"..\..\folder1\folder2\"
有没有更好的方法/选项来附加路径,而不是自己创建函数 PathCchAppendEx和PathCchCombine具有相同的结果。
答案 0 :(得分:0)
无法将两个相对路径与此系列的某个功能组合在一起。我将使用GetCurrentDirectory()或GetModuleFileName()获取绝对路径(取决于您的情况)并将其与第一个路径组合,然后将结果与第二个路径组合。通常你总是有一些点,你可以建立一个绝对的路径开始。